UNC NIRL Research featured in UNC Health Care News Release
Neurological underpinnings of schizophrenia just as complex as the disorder itself New analysis links cognitive, emotional, and intellectual symptoms to neurological “disruption” in multiple brain regions – a finding with important implications for diagnosis and treatment.

Dr Belger Elected As Member of American College of Neuropsychopharmacology
Aysenil Belger has been elected as a member of the American College of Neuropsychopharmacology (ACNP). ACNP Bulletin, Volume 18, Issue 1
